Popular E-Commerce Business Models

  • Dropshipping: Sell products without storing inventory. Your supplier ships directly to your customer.
  • Print-on-Demand: Create custom merchandise — shirts, mugs, posters — printed and shipped on demand.
  • Private Label: Rebrand manufacturer products and sell under your own name.
  • Digital Goods: Sell templates, ebooks, courses, or digital artwork.
  • Artisan Products: Offer handmade or unique goods via your website or marketplaces like Etsy.

Your First E-Commerce Setup

Starting doesn’t require a huge budget. Here’s what you need:

  • Online Platform: Try Shopify, WooCommerce, or Etsy.
  • Product Source: Use suppliers like AliExpress, POD platforms, or make items yourself.
  • Brand Identity: Design your logo and visuals using Canva or AI-based tools.
  • Payment Setup: Enable PayPal, Stripe, or other processors.
  • Traffic Plan: Learn to attract visitors using SEO, ads, or social media.

How to Spot Great Products

What you sell matters more than how your store looks. Here’s how to find winners:

  • Watch social media trends on TikTok and Instagram.
  • Use tools like Minea, Ecomhunt, or Pexda to research products.
  • Read product reviews to find gaps or customer frustrations.
  • Test fast — small ad budgets help you learn what works.

Focus on items that solve a pain point, spark emotion, or feel innovative.

Boosting Sales with Smart Marketing

Even great products won’t sell without visibility. These are effective beginner strategies in 2025:

  • Short-Form Video: Use TikTok and Reels to show off your product in action.
  • Social Media Branding: Build an identity that’s memorable and trustworthy.
  • Ad Campaigns: Use Meta or TikTok ads to get traffic fast.
  • Email Funnels: Use Klaviyo or Mailchimp to turn visitors into repeat buyers.

What to Watch Out For

  • Jumping on trends without testing or knowing your niche.
  • Spending weeks perfecting branding before launching.
  • Neglecting shipping times or customer experience.
  • Giving up after one product fails — most successes come after multiple tries.
